Medical definition of child guidance: the clinical study and treatment of the behavioral and emotional problems of children by a staff of specialists usually comprising a physician or psychiatrist, a clinical psychologist, and a psychiatric social worker. According to these practices, the purpose of child guidance, or discipline, is not to control young children but to help them learn to be cooperative. The following child guidance procedures are preventative, not punitive, and are designed to help children accept responsibility for their actions, exercise self-control, develop social consciousness, and acquire the skills necessary for lifelong success in the real world.Positive child guidance techniques are one component of a quality child care program. Children's behavior has purpose. The most effective techniques help children learn how to accept responsibility for their actions and empower them to exercise self-control.
